
Senior Relationship Manager (Agriculture Lending)

- Develop, manage, and expand a high-value portfolio of agricultural and commercial lending relationships
- Serve as a trusted financial advisor to agricultural producers, agribusiness owners, commercial customers, and rural landowners
- Build and maintain strong relationships with customers, referral sources, business leaders, and community stakeholders throughout the region
- Identify opportunities for new business development, portfolio growth, and expanded customer relationships
- Structure, negotiate, and present complex lending solutions tailored to customer needs
- Analyze financial statements, repayment ability, collateral, operational performance, and overall credit risk
- Conduct on-site farm visits, business visits, and customer meetings to strengthen relationships and better understand operations
- Maintain strong knowledge of agricultural markets, commodity trends, farm operations, rural economies, and commercial lending environments
- Collaborate with internal credit and leadership teams to ensure sound underwriting, risk management, and portfolio administration
- Represent River Valley Ag Credit professionally within the community through networking, industry involvement, and relationship-building activities
- Assist in mentoring and supporting less experienced lenders and team members when appropriate
- Maintain compliance with all applicable lending regulations, internal policies, and Association standards
-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Agricultural Economics, Agriculture, Finance, Accounting, or related field preferred
- Significant experience in agricultural lending, commercial banking, relationship management, portfolio management, or business development
- Strong understanding of agricultural operations, agribusiness, and rural financial markets preferred
- Proven ability to build, manage, and grow substantial customer portfolio
- Established community and professional relationships within the region strongly preferred
- Strong analytical, communication, negotiation, and interpersonal skills
- Demonstrated ability to develop new business and maintain long-term customer relationships
- Knowledge of Farm Credit System operations and agricultural finance principles preferred
- Leadership presence with the ability to work independently and strategically within a growing organization
